Million-Dollar Yacht Capsizes Minutes After Launch in Turkey

Author auto.pub | Published on: 04.09.2025

What should have been a moment of pride on Turkey’s Black Sea coast turned into instant embarrassment. In the port of Zonguldak, the brand-new yacht Dolce Vento — valued at $1.4 million — capsized just minutes after being launched for its maiden voyage.

The incident, caught on a bystander’s phone on September 2, shows the vessel sliding smoothly into the water before suddenly losing balance and rolling onto its side. The short inaugural trip, meant to celebrate the yacht’s completion, instead became a public disaster.

Zonguldak, better known as a tranquil tourist destination, unexpectedly found itself trending online as the video went viral, provoking both schadenfreude and questions about how such a fundamental mishap could happen.

One certainty remains: the name Dolce Vento — “sweet wind” in Italian — will now be remembered less for dreams of carefree sailing and more for a bitterly ironic debut.
